Add option request-zoneversion

This can be set at the option, view and server levels and causes
named to add an EDNS ZONEVERSION option to requests.  Replies are
logged to the 'zoneversion' category.

.. namedconf:statement:: request-zoneversion
:tags: query
:short: Controls whether an empty EDNS(0) ZONEVERSION option is sent with all queries to authoritative name servers during iterative resolution.
If ``yes``, then an empty EDNS(0) ZONEVERSION option is sent
with all queries to authoritative name servers during iterative
resolution. If the authoritative server returns an ZONEVERSION
option in its response, then its contents are logged in the
``zoneversion`` category at level ``info``. If the NSID has
also been requested and it is returned then that is appended to
the log message. The default is ``no``.

static void
log_zoneversion(unsigned char *version, size_t version_len, unsigned char *nsid,
size_t nsid_len, resquery_t *query, int level,
isc_mem_t *mctx) {
char addrbuf[ISC_SOCKADDR_FORMATSIZE];
char namebuf[DNS_NAME_FORMATSIZE];
size_t nsid_buflen = 0;
char *nsid_buf = NULL;
char *nsid_pbuf = NULL;
const char *nsid_hex = "";
const char *nsid_print = "";
const char *sep_1 = "";
const char *sep_2 = "";
const char *sep_3 = "";
dns_name_t suffix = DNS_NAME_INITEMPTY;
unsigned int labels;
REQUIRE(version_len <= UINT16_MAX);
/*
* Don't log reflected ZONEVERSION option.
*/
if (version_len == 0) {
return;
}
/* Enforced by dns_rdata_fromwire. */
INSIST(version_len >= 2);
/*
* Sanity check on label count.
*/
labels = version[0] + 1;
if (dns_name_countlabels(query->fctx->name) < labels) {
return;
}
/*
* Get zone name.
*/
dns_name_split(query->fctx->name, labels, NULL, &suffix);
dns_name_format(&suffix, namebuf, sizeof(namebuf));
if (nsid != NULL) {
nsid_buflen = nsid_len * 2 + 1;
nsid_hex = nsid_buf = isc_mem_get(mctx, nsid_buflen);
nsid_print = nsid_pbuf = isc_mem_get(mctx, nsid_len + 1);
/* Convert to hex */
make_hex(nsid, nsid_len, nsid_buf, nsid_buflen);
/* Convert to printable */
make_printable(nsid, nsid_len, nsid_pbuf, nsid_len + 1);
sep_1 = " (NSID ";
sep_2 = " (";
sep_3 = "))";
}
isc_sockaddr_format(&query->addrinfo->sockaddr, addrbuf,
sizeof(addrbuf));
if (version[1] == 0 && version_len == 6) {
uint32_t serial = version[2] << 24 | version[3] << 2 |
version[4] << 8 | version[5];
isc_log_write(DNS_LOGCATEGORY_ZONEVERSION,
DNS_LOGMODULE_RESOLVER, level,
"received ZONEVERSION serial %u from %s for %s "
"zone %s%s%s%s%s%s",
serial, addrbuf, query->fctx->info, namebuf,
sep_1, nsid_hex, sep_2, nsid_print, sep_3);
} else {
size_t version_buflen = version_len * 2 + 1;
char *version_hex = isc_mem_get(mctx, version_buflen);
char *version_pbuf = isc_mem_get(mctx, version_len - 1);
/* Convert to hex */
make_hex(version + 2, version_len - 2, version_hex,
version_buflen);
/* Convert to printable */
make_printable(version + 2, version_len - 2, version_pbuf,
version_len - 1);
isc_log_write(DNS_LOGCATEGORY_ZONEVERSION,
DNS_LOGMODULE_RESOLVER, level,
"received ZONEVERSION type %u value %s (%s) from "
"%s for %s zone %s%s%s%s%s%s",
version[1], version_hex, version_pbuf, addrbuf,
query->fctx->info, namebuf, sep_1, nsid_hex,
sep_2, nsid_print, sep_3);
isc_mem_put(mctx, version_hex, version_buflen);
isc_mem_put(mctx, version_pbuf, version_len - 1);
}
if (nsid_pbuf != NULL) {
isc_mem_put(mctx, nsid_pbuf, nsid_len + 1);
}
if (nsid_buf != NULL) {
isc_mem_put(mctx, nsid_buf, nsid_buflen);
}
}
